Re: funcion replace

From: Anthony Sotolongo <asotolongo(at)gmail(dot)com>
To: MARIA ANTONIETA RAMIREZ SOLIS <maramirez(at)ulsaneza(dot)edu(dot)mx>
Cc: POSTGRES <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Re: funcion replace
Date: 2017-09-01 17:07:35
Message-ID: CAASDfF1UPo8K=bcHmrLfZcJ_8CwbJU4ASL2bADbJArrHb3mFEQ@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Creo que te falta después del set descripción=replace...

El 1 sep. 2017 2:05 PM, "Maria Antonieta Ramirez" <maramirez(at)ulsaneza(dot)edu(dot)mx>
escribió:

Hola , gracias por contestar..

si yo hago update:

UPDATE educaciondistancia.contenidos_maestria
Set replace (descripcion ,'/maestriaLineaV1/', '/MaestriaLineaAdmon/')
where id in (81);

me manda el siguiente error:

ERROR: syntax error at or near "("
LINE 3: Set replace (descripcion ,'/maestriaLineaV1/', '/MaestriaLi...
^

********** Error **********

ERROR: syntax error at or near "("
SQL state: 42601
Character: 62

------------------------------
*De:* Anthony Sotolongo <asotolongo(at)gmail(dot)com>
*Enviado:* viernes, 1 de septiembre de 2017 11:47:32
*Para:* Maria Antonieta Ramirez
*Cc:* POSTGRES
*Asunto:* Re: funcion replace

Hola María Antonieta, te refieres a hacer un update
*educaciondistancia.contenidos_maestria *
*Set replace...*

*Saludos *
El 1 sep. 2017 1:29 PM, "Maria Antonieta Ramirez" <maramirez(at)ulsaneza(dot)edu(dot)mx>
escribió:

Hola buen dia,

De ante mano les agradezco toda su atencion por leerme..

Miren tengo la siguiente duda ojala me puedan ayudar.

Tengo una tabla que se llama contenidos, dentro de ella tengo un campo que
se llama descripcion, dentro de ese campo se almacena una url como por
ejemplo:

<img src="/maestriaLineaV1/img/Icono-excel.png"

en esa url quiero cambiar: maestriaLineaV1 por maestria5, este campo lo
quiero hacer a todos los registros de mi tabla.

yo busque la funcion replace, y al ejecutar lo siguiente si me muestra un
resultado con la cadena cambiada.

*select replace(descripcion ,'/maestriaLineaV1/', '/MaestriaLineaAdmon/')
*

*from educaciondistancia.contenidos_maestria *

Sin embargo si yo le doy un refresh al registro, me vuele a mostrar la
cadena sin el valor cambiado.

mi duda es ¿como le puedo hacer para que realmente haga el cambio?

sin mas por el momento les agradezco su atención.

In response to

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Maria Antonieta Ramirez 2017-09-01 17:08:12 Re: funcion replace
Previous Message Maria Antonieta Ramirez 2017-09-01 17:05:21 Re: funcion replace